.Our overall experience with this company has not been good. We recently built a new house on the 18th green of a golf course. We received 3 bids for the landscaping and irrigation of our property. Although the bid from Southern Designs Landscaping and Irrigation was the highest bid, we chose them because they told us they would gaurantee their work and that the sod would be "certified" Bermuda 419 Tif. When we received the bids from the two other landscapers, they both recommended french drains in front and on the east side of our house because of the water that collects there when it rains. The "expert" from Southern Designs assured us that they would be able to grade our yard in such a way that the water would run off and we would not need to install a french drain.
WEEDS IN SOD: We have an excessive amount of weeds in the sod we received (even though we paid for 419 Tif). The landscaping company sprayed for weeds once, but it rained about 5 hours after they sprayed. Our sod has gone dormant for the Winter, so I guess we'll see what issues we have when Spring comes.
SPRINKLERS IN FLOWER BEDS: Everything went fine with the installation, however, we had a problem with the sprinklers in our flower beds. We did not plant our flower beds until 2 1/2 months later because of the heat so we did not run the spinklers in the beds. When we went to turn on the sprinklers in the flower beds, the zones for half of the beds were not working. When we called the company representative, he told my husband there was probably dirt in the sprinkler heads and that my husband should blow out the heads. We paid $24.5K for the irrigation and sod...why were we being told to perform maintenance on a system that was less than 3 months old???
They finally sent someone out to find out why the zones in the flower beds were not working. Come to find out, the zone was not hooked up at the control box. In addition, we were orginally told we had 3 zones in the flower beds, but in reality, only 2 zones were installed (we have flower beds around our entire 3000 sf house). In addition, when the zones were installed no consideration was given to the fact that our North facing flower beds do not need as much water as our South and West facing flower beds because our North flower beds stay shaded and our South/West flower beds get full sun. Also we have several lawn sprinklers that shoot into the flower beds causing spots in the beds to be over watered (not to mention they hit our windows and leave hard water marks too). "We" have to fix this issue ourselves because they will not return to adjust the sprinklers.
DRAINAGE PROBLEMS: In addition, we did need the french drains. Although the representative from Southern Designs Landscpaing assured us that they would be able to grade our front and east side to prevent standing water during rain; the front and East side of our house get flooded every time it rains. When we hired them as "landscapers" , we expected our yard to be properly "landscaped". We did not expect to have to hire someone else to dig up our yard 4-5 months later to fix an issue that they told us they would take care of during the initial installation of our irrigation/sod.
We feel that Southern Designs Landscpaing and Irrigation have pretty much taken our money and ran, despite the fact they they gave us "1 year warranty on parts and labor".
